David and Goliath (Comprehensive Summary)

In 'David and Goliath', Malcolm Gladwell explores the dynamics of underdogs and advantages, challenging traditional notions of strength and success. Through a series of compelling stories and research, he illustrates how perceived disadvantages can lead to unexpected advantages, reshaping our understanding of resilience and strategy.
